Newington Train Station is designed with efficiency in mind, ensuring travelers have access to essential services. You'll find a ticket office that operates on Monday and Friday from 06:10 to 10:10, alongside ticket machines available round the clock. Accessible ticket machines are conveniently positioned in the station forecourt, making life easier for those with mobility challenges. While the station doesn't boast extravagant lounges or refreshment facilities, it offers seating areas where you can relax as you await your train. Additionally, a reliable CCTV system ensures your safety throughout the station premises.
Recognizing the importance of accessibility, Newington Station provides step-free access to Platform 1, although Platform 2 is only accessible via a footbridge. Assistance is available through a help point, and staff assist during morning hours. Customers with mobility challenges are encouraged to make travel arrangements beforehand, ensuring a seamless journey. While wheelchairs are not available and there's no step-free interchange between platforms, friendly on-board staff are ready to lend a hand when needed.

While Pembroke Dock train station doesn't have a staffed ticket office, it compensates with modern ticket machines, allowing for quick ticket collections and purchases using major credit or debit cards. For those requiring assistance, staff are reachable via a helpline, ensuring travelers feel confident throughout their journey. A thoughtful nod to accessibility, the station boasts step-free access from its car park to the platform, making it comfortable for travelers with mobility needs. Unfortunately, facilities like waiting rooms, restrooms, and lounges are not available, making the station a quick in and out pit stop for travelers.
Finding your way to a new destination from Pembroke Dock is quite straightforward. Although the station itself lacks bicycle hire facilities and local taxis or car rental services, alternatives like the rail replacement bus ensure smooth transitions. The bus stop is conveniently located at the rear of the station, allowing for easy planning when rail services are disrupted.
